bicycle repair shop in New Crofton

About 52 results.

Halfords

York Road, LS14 6AX Leeds, United Kingdom

Looking for Halfords 0878LEEDS, YORK ROAD store? You'll find the address, postcode, phone number, map opening hours and store info on halfords.com.

Motor World Wakefield

Horbury Road 201, WF2 8RB Wakefield, United Kingdom